Seismic Engineering & Structural Compliance in New Zealand

In New Zealand, commercial shelving systems and warehouse racking are strictly regulated under the Building Act 2004 and the Health and Safety at Work Act (HSWA). Compliance with structural guidelines, specifically AS/NZS 1170 (Structural Design Actions) and the dedicated steel storage racking standard AS 4084, is mandatory. Racking and heavy display stands must withstand horizontal seismic force coefficients to ensure that under seismic events, the structures remain stable and do not collapse, protecting the lives of workers and shoppers alike.

Do DuraRacks shelving systems comply with New Zealand's AS/NZS seismic engineering standards?
Yes, our engineering team designs shelving and storage racking configurations to meet the specific horizontal seismic force demands of AS/NZS 1170.4 and AS 4084. We run structural calculations and finite element simulations to make sure that the rack heights, thickness parameters, bracing structures, and floor anchoring meet local compliance requirements for commercial retail spaces in Auckland, Wellington, and Christchurch.
What steel grades and anti-corrosion processes are used for units exported to NZ?
We use high-grade Q235B cold-rolled structural carbon steel for all critical framing, beams, and upright posts. The surface treatment consists of a rigorous multi-stage chemical wash, followed by the application of an electrostatic powder-coating baked at 180°C. This creates a hard shell of 80 to 120 microns, offering great resistance to scratching and excellent protection against salt-air humidity in New Zealand’s coastal areas.
How long does shipping take from Nanjing Port to main New Zealand ports?
The standard lead time for custom fabrication and loading is 20 to 30 days. Transit time via ocean shipping from Shanghai/Nanjing port to major New Zealand ports (Auckland, Tauranga, Lyttelton) is approximately 18 to 25 days. In total, expect delivery to your site or warehouse within 40 to 55 days from final order sign-off.
